Tonight is bank holiday, and we will not have a lindy hop class! Instead, come along to Summerhill Bowling Club for themed classes on shag for balboa dancers, taught by Rachael and Joel. We will learn to dance shag in a small and relaxed way, making it perfect for dancers that like to conserve their energy on the social floor even to the fastest songs, or for those who need to be mindful of their joints and muscles.

June Improvers+ Shag Workshop – Caroline & Joe

Saturday 7th June, St Matthew’s Church

We are super thrilled to announce our June improver+ workshop with visiting instructors Caroline and Joe. You can expect four hours of progressive content, from enhancing your fundamental technique all the way to learning exciting new variations.

Introducing our teachers:

“Joe started dancing in Manchester in 2016. Though his journey began with lindy hop, he quickly discovered his love for shag, with its fast movement and fun style. His teaching stomping grounds were at Manshagster, where he started out before moving his practice to Lancaster with teaching partner Caroline. Nowadays, you will find him teaching weekly classes at Swing North.

Joe is known to enjoy all swing dances as both a leader and follower, and switching dance styles at any tempo. When he isn’t attending local and international festivals, he is practicing footwork in his kitchen!

Caroline’s love affair with shag began shortly after she started dancing in Manchester in 2018. After moving to Lancaster, she continued to grow her passion by joining the local committee, travelling to events across the country and committing several evenings per week to her dancing. She is now back in Manchester teaching shag with dance partner Joe.

Caroline believes that, by creating a playful and relaxed class atmosphere, she can foster a better, more enjoyable learning environment. She takes care to encourage open dialogue, sharing, and experimentation in her classes. Her teaching approach is focused on helping students develop their technique by anchoring it to attuned connection with the partner and the music.”
